Home
Features
Pricing
Contact Us
Live Streaming
Pseudolive
Video Hosting
TV Apps
Infrastructure
Login
Sign Up
Home
Live Streaming
Pseudolive
Video Hosting
TV
Infrastructure
Pricing
Contact Us
Login
Signup
Looking to launch your own channel?
Get in touch and we'll follow up quickly!
Submit
The following errors occured: